Vanuatu Builds Skills in Kids’ Athletics Training

Vanuatu is taking part in a regional training programme aimed at developing athletics at the grassroots level and encouraging more children to enjoy and participate in the sport.

Athletics Vanuatu Secretary General Jennifer Atisson and coach Sandy Molu are representing Vanuatu at the World Athletics Kids’ Athletics Train the Trainer course in Honiara, Solomon Islands.

The programme focuses not only on training children to compete but also on making athletics enjoyable and accessible while helping them develop basic sporting skills.

Atisson said the participants had already learned a lot during the first two days of the programme and were preparing to put their new knowledge into practice.

“We enjoyed and learned a lot from day one to day two, and today we will put into practice what we have learned.”

The Kids’ Athletics programme is designed to give children a positive introduction to athletics through simple, fun and engaging activities.

The training is expected to help develop local trainers who can share the skills and knowledge gained from the programme with children and other coaches in Vanuatu.
